AUGELLO v. DENIGRIS


239 A.D.2d 372 (1997)

658 N.Y.S.2d 882

Paul Augello, Jr., Respondent, v. Joseph Denigris et al., Appellants

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

May 12, 1997


Ordered that the order is affirmed, with costs.

The affirmation prepared by the defendants' expert which was submitted in opposition to the plaintiff's motion presented no triable issues of fact as to whether the defendant Joseph Denigris was negligent in falling asleep at the wheel of an automobile while driving (cf., Harvey v Dileno, 35 A.D.2d 668; Cicero v Clark, 23 A.D.2d 583
